#ba44a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ba44a8 is composed of 72.9% red, 26.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 309.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 49.8%. #ba44a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#750051.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#ba44a8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ba44a8 has RGB values of R:186, G:68,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.1,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12207272.

Hex triplet ba44a8 #ba44a8
RGB Decimal 186, 68, 168 rgb(186,68,168)
RGB Percent 72.9, 26.7, 65.9 rgb(72.9%,26.7%,65.9%)
CMYK 0, 63, 10, 27
HSL 309.2°, 46.5, 49.8 hsl(309.2,46.5%,49.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 309.2°, 63.4, 72.9
Web Safe cc3399 #cc3399
CIE-LAB 48.763, 58.936, -30.199
XYZ 29.384, 17.402, 38.855
xyY 0.343, 0.203, 17.402
CIE-LCH 48.763, 66.223, 332.869
CIE-LUV 48.763, 57.661, -52.934
Hunter-Lab 41.716, 52.73, -26.022
Binary 10111010, 01000100, 10101000

Shades and Tints of #ba44a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e050c is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ba44a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f7f is the less saturated color, while #f509d1 is the most saturated one.
